Re: 4850 fanless

I've got a fanless 4850, same one as you linked to, been using it for about 4-5 months now. Was really sceptical about heating issues based on the fan versions generating huge levels of heat.

At idle, it sits at around 50-55 degrees with the case fans barely moving (so very little air flow in the case).

When gaming, I've manage to get it no higher than 80degrees. Can't recommend the card enough
